The main difference between a regular key and a remote car key is that the former uses the traditional mechanical key, and the latter features an embedded microchip. The microchip is an electronic device that transmits data about the key to the car's computer. The microchip is also designed to prevent the car from starting when the key that is not the correct one is used. Transponder keys are not duplicated using the standard key cutter. However they can be made using special equipment.

You can also purchase an additional transponder-based key through your auto locksmith or dealer. The cost can vary, but is usually between $220 to $475. You may have to pay extra for changing of your key's programming to fit your car. The most expensive keys include those that incorporate keys and remotes into one unit, like the Fobik Key that is used in Chrysler cars or proximity key used by Mercedes and Infiniti.
